#4b9c5d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b9c5d is composed of 29.4% red, 61.2%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.4%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 133.3 degrees, a saturation of 35.1% and a lightness of 45.3%. #4b9c5d color hex could be obtained by blending #96ffba with #003900.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

● #4b9c5d color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#4b9c5d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4b9c5d has RGB values of R:75, G:156,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 4955229.

Shades and Tints of #4b9c5d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a06 is the darkest color, while #fcf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b9c5d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f7871 is the less saturated color, while #04e336 is the most saturated one.
